Description
Light, fresh cucumber sandwiches with a creamy herb spread, perfect for tea time, snacks, or quick gatherings.
Ingredients
- 1 large cucumber, thinly sliced
- 8 slices soft white or whole wheat bread
- 120 g cream cheese, softened
- 2 tablespoons mayonnaise
- 1 tablespoon fresh dill, finely chopped (or 1 teaspoon dried dill)
- 1 teaspoon lemon juice
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 tablespoon butter, softened (optional)
Instructions
- Wash the cucumber thoroughly and slice it into very thin rounds. Pat dry with a paper towel to remove excess moisture.
- In a bowl, mix the softened cream cheese, mayonnaise, dill, lemon juice, salt, and pepper until smooth.
- Spread a thin layer of butter on each slice of bread if using.
- Spread the cream cheese mixture evenly over all slices of bread.
- Arrange cucumber slices over half of the bread slices, slightly overlapping.
- Top with the remaining bread slices to form sandwiches.
- Gently press together, trim crusts if desired, and cut into halves or quarters before serving.
Notes
- Pat cucumbers dry to prevent soggy sandwiches.
- Best served fresh for optimal texture and flavor.
- Butter acts as a moisture barrier for longer freshness.
- Can customize with herbs like chives or parsley.
- Add smoked salmon for a richer variation.
